Yes, you should discard pillows if you have bed bugs. Pillows can house these pests and their eggs, making it difficult to eliminate them completely. Enclose new pillows in bed bug-proof covers and be sure to treat your entire sleeping area to prevent re-infestation. Washing bedding in hot water and using a professional pest control service can also help.
